Subject: DR drill next week — pool failover

Hi plugin folks,

Heads up: next Tuesday we're running a disaster-recovery drill on the Copperline connection pooler. Your plugins may see brief pool exhaustion while we yank the primary and force failover — please don't page anyone, it's intentional. If your test harness needs to reconnect through the emergency pool endpoint, authentication falls back to passphrase mode during the drill. Use the recovery passphrase shown directly below.

unlock words, yawig-kagef: gordor-holvan-ulaael-pramir-ulaiel-tamdor

Subject: DR drill — catalogue import

Team, during Thursday's disaster-recovery drill we will restore the Lanternfield library catalogue import pipeline from cold backups. Please verify the MARC record counts match the pre-drill snapshot before re-enabling nightly syncs. The restore console for the Shelfwright service will prompt for the recovery passphrase noted below.

recovery phrase for fawif-tajeg: norael-aldmir-casir-brivan-ulaion

## Deploying the Gatewick Proctor Queue

Deploys are pretty painless: push to main, wait for the pipeline, then watch the queue drain dashboard for five minutes. If candidates pile up mid-exam, roll back first and ask questions later — the queue replays safely. Everything the workers care about lives in one config block, shown here for reference.

settings of bafof-yagef:
JOROX_PIN=8740
JOROX_TENANT=pelox
JOROX_METRICS_HOST=metrics.jorox.qorvelworks.internal
JOROX_SEAL=seal_c78f63c1
JOROX_STANDBY_TEAM=norax